Well yesterday I pulled out all the interior of my truck and dropped the trany. Still waiting for the flywheel to be refaced and then I'll put the new clutch on, so it will probably be back together on Friday since I won't be working on it tomorrow. Just finished putting in sound dampener this evening on the floor board and washed the vinyl floor cover, just waiting for it to dry.

was pretty easy to pull the trany with the truck on the ramps. Was able to use gravity to move the trany while holding it up.

The plan is to replace the worn out clutch and since I had it in the garage I decided to replace the sound barrier since it was all pretty much gone. Just keeping her nice for driving back and forth for work.
